Structural optimization of 4-(2-chlorophenyl)-9-methyl-6H-thieno [3,2-f][1,2,4]triazolo[4,3-a][1,4]diazepines as antagonists for platelet activating factor: Pharmacological contribution of substituents at the 2- and 6-positions of a condensed ring system

A series of 4-(2-chlorophenyl)-9-methyl-6H-thieno [3,2-f][1,2,4]triazolo[4,3-a][1,4]diazepine derivatives bearing substituents at the 2- and 6-positions were synthesized, and evaluated in vitro for their inhibitory activity on rabbit platelet aggregation induced by platelet activating factor (PAF) and in vivo for their preventing effect on PAF-induced mortality in mice. The length of alkyl or arylalkyl side chain at the 2-position was responsible for enhancing the affinity for the PAF receptor. The simultaneous substitution at both the 2- and 6-positions resulted in a successful separation of the affinity for the PAF receptor from that for the benzodiazepine (BZ) receptor. Thus, (±)-4-(2-chlorophenyl)-2-[2-(4-isobutylphenyl)ethyl]- 6,9-dimethyl-6H-thieno[3,2-f][1,2,4]triazolo[4,3-a][1,4] diazepine (Y-24180) was confirmed to be a specific antagonist for the PAF receptor and is currently under clinical trials.
Optically active thienotriazolodiazepine compounds

Stable crystals of an acid addition salt of an optically active thienotriazolodiazepine compound or its hydrate of the formula STR1 wherein R1 is hydrogen, R2 is 2-phenylethyl substituted by alkyl having 1 to 5 carbon atoms, 2-morpholinocarbonylethyl or alkyl having 6 to 12 carbon atoms, or R1 and R2 may combinedly form a saturated 5-membered ring having one substituent selected from the group consisting of morpholinomethyl, morpholinocarbonyl and N,N-dipropylcarbamoyl, R3 is halogen, alkyl having 1 to 5 carbon atoms or alkoxy having 1 to 5 carbon atoms, R4 is trifluoromethyl or alkyl having 1 to 5 carbon atoms, R5 is hydrogen or methyl, m is 1-2, and n is 0-2. The present invention provides optically active thienotriazolodiazepine compounds having strong PAF-antagonistic activity as markedly stable crystals which are excellent in crystalline property, permit purification by recrystallization, and have high chemical purity and optical purity, thereby rendering industrial large-scale synthesis attainable. In addition, crystallization thereof facilitates medicinal standardization and pharmaceutical formulation.
